Zakir Husain Delhi College Announces Centenary Alumni Meet for 2026
In a landmark announcement, Zakir Husain Delhi College has revealed plans to host a grand centenary alumni meet in 2026. This event will commemorate a full century of the institution's rich history, academic prowess, and its profound impact on countless students over the decades. The college, located in the heart of New Delhi, aims to bring together graduates from various batches to celebrate this significant milestone and reinforce the enduring bonds of community and learning.
A Century of Belonging and Excellence
The centenary alumni meet is themed "A Century of Belonging, A Legacy of Excellence," reflecting the college's commitment to fostering a sense of unity and pride among its alumni. Since its establishment, Zakir Husain Delhi College has been a beacon of higher education, contributing significantly to the fields of arts, sciences, and commerce. The 2026 event will serve as a platform to honor this legacy, showcasing the achievements of its alumni and the institution's role in shaping future leaders.
Organizers have emphasized that the meet will not only be a nostalgic reunion but also an opportunity to discuss the future of education and alumni engagement. Activities are expected to include keynote speeches, panel discussions, cultural performances, and networking sessions, all designed to highlight the college's ongoing contributions to society and its plans for continued growth and innovation.
